2. Establish The Firm’s Keyword

Law firm SEO services start with establishing keywords to rank on different search engines. The keywords are phrases added to the web content for clients to find the site via search engines. Google and other search engines use the key phrases to determine the relevant content for specific search queries.

The keyword links what the clients are searching for and the content to fulfill the need. Keywords are about the clients. There is a need to understand the needs of the clients and the type of content they seek. Talking to clients and frequenting community groups is one of the ways to find keywords.

There are also tools to help in optimizing the keywords. Some examples include Semrush and Moz. However, there are free ones such as Google Trends. Answer The Public can help identify relevant questions and searches.

3. Integrate Keywords In The Website Content

Research on the keywords and determine how they rank. Incorporate the high-ranking keywords into the landing pages, the home page, and blog posts. Use the keywords on title tags, the first place that search engines scan. Title tags are the actual link text that appears on the search engine result page.

The title tag is the means of navigation of online law firm clients. It is what they see on their web browsers. Keywords are also used on meta description tags. The meta keywords should relate to the content. Headers and subheaders should also have keywords to benefit people scanning through the web content.

The law firm’s web content is the backbone of the website. The keyword density in the web content determines the search results. However, it should be captivating to read to increase the conversion rate.

Clients in your location find you easily if you incorporate local keywords. The search results will likely show the client firms around them.

5. Include Metadata and Title Tags

Meta tags are unseen tags that make it easier for law clients on different search engines to determine the firm’s web content. Title tags and meta tags suggest to potential clients about the firm. They also inform search engines algorithms about the website for higher ranking.

The title tag is a hypertext markup language component that indicates the title of the firm’s webpage. The title tags appear in search engine result pages.

6. Include Links

The links cite the reference with a clickable link that takes clients directly to the reference page. The clickable link is called a hyperlink, whereas the anchor text is the clickable part of the text.

The phrase contained in the anchor text helps establish the ranking of the page by various search engines. The anchor text is connected to the linked page. SEO-friendly anchor text should encompass the target page relevance and have low keyword density.

The firm should be listed on legal directories such as lawyers.com to link it to the website. Business collaborations can also be a source of links.

7. Complete the Firm’s Google My Business Page

Google My Business is a professional yet free website for firms. It is created using details of your business and has an auto-update option. This website helps to communicate with clients across the google search.

Completing the firm’s Google My Business page enhances online visibility. It is easier to create an account on the Google My Business page. You only head to google.com/business and sign in with a Gmail account. You then open the location of the firm.

The Google My Business page provides critical information about the law firm to potential clients. Photographs, areas of practice, contact information, and location can be accessed on this page.
